package pubsub
import (
"context"
"log"
"sync/atomic"
"testing"
"time"
"cloud.google.com/go/pubsub/pstest"
"google.golang.org/api/option"
"google.golang.org/grpc"
)
// Using the fake PubSub server in the pstest package, verify that streaming
// pull resumes if the server stream times out.
func TestStreamTimeout(t *testing.T) {
t.Parallel()
log.SetFlags(log.Lmicroseconds)
ctx := context.Background()
srv := pstest.NewServer()
defer srv.Close()
srv.SetStreamTimeout(2 * time.Second)
conn, err := grpc.Dial(srv.Addr, grpc.WithInsecure())
if err != nil {
t.Fatal(err)
}
defer conn.Close()
opts := withGRPCHeadersAssertion(t, option.WithGRPCConn(conn))
client, err := NewClient(ctx, "P", opts...)
if err != nil {
t.Fatal(err)
}
defer client.Close()
topic, err := client.CreateTopic(ctx, "T")
if err != nil {
t.Fatal(err)
}
sub, err := client.CreateSubscription(ctx, "sub", SubscriptionConfig{Topic: topic, AckDeadline: 10 * time.Second})
if err != nil {
t.Fatal(err)
}
const nPublish = 8
rctx, cancel := context.WithTimeout(ctx, 30*time.Second)
defer cancel()
errc := make(chan error)
var nSeen int64
go func() {
errc <- sub.Receive(rctx, func(ctx context.Context, m *Message) {
m.Ack()
n := atomic.AddInt64(&nSeen, 1)
if n >= nPublish {
cancel()
}
})
}()
for i := 0; i < nPublish; i++ {
pr := topic.Publish(ctx, &Message{Data: []byte("msg")})
_, err := pr.Get(ctx)
if err != nil {
t.Fatal(err)
}
time.Sleep(250 * time.Millisecond)
}
if err := <-errc; err != nil {
t.Fatal(err)
}
if err := sub.Delete(ctx); err != nil {
t.Fatal(err)
}
n := atomic.LoadInt64(&nSeen)
if n < nPublish {
t.Errorf("got %d messages, want %d", n, nPublish)
}
}
